for 循环bug修复

master
hwf452 2 years ago
parent 6d11ae6a11
commit f361e67a3b

@ -22,6 +22,7 @@ import android.widget.TextView;
import com.azhon.appupdate.listener.OnButtonClickListener;
import com.azhon.appupdate.listener.OnDownloadListener;
import com.azhon.appupdate.manager.DownloadManager;
import com.bjzc.yfdxj.BuildConfig;
import com.bjzc.yfdxj.base.BaseCallBackNoProgress;
import com.bjzc.yfdxj.R;
import com.bjzc.yfdxj.base.BaseActivity;
@ -187,12 +188,13 @@ public class LoginActivity extends BaseActivity {
}
}
// etUse.setText("161619");
// etPwd.setText("lgy12345");
if (BuildConfig.LOG_ERROR) {
etUse.setText("161619");
etPwd.setText("lgy12345");
// etUse.setText("161619");
// etPwd.setText("161619");
}
//使用完一定记得关闭 电源
mt.RFIDclose();
mt.IRTclose();

@ -562,13 +562,21 @@ public class ScxsjhFragment extends BaseFragment {
MeasureDialog measureDialog = new MeasureDialog(context, "你确定要删除?", new MeasureDialog.AuditDialogListener() {
@Override
public void confirm() {
for (int i = 0; i < dbxjjh.size(); i++) {
if (dbxjjh.get(i).isChecked()) {
DataSupport.deleteAll(XSJJHXZDataBean.class, "zxid = ? and username = ?", dbxjjh.get(i).getZxid(), username);
DataSupport.deleteAll(XSJJHDataBean.class, "zxid = ? and username = ?", dbxjjh.get(i).getZxid(), username);
DataSupport.deleteAll(Xjjh.class, "zxid = ? and username = ?", dbxjjh.get(i).getZxid(), username);
}
dbxjjh.removeIf((item) -> {
if (item.isChecked()) {
DataSupport.deleteAll(XSJJHXZDataBean.class, "zxid = ? and username = ?", item.getZxid(), username);
DataSupport.deleteAll(XSJJHDataBean.class, "zxid = ? and username = ?", item.getZxid(), username);
DataSupport.deleteAll(Xjjh.class, "zxid = ? and username = ?", item.getZxid(), username);
}
return item.isChecked();
});
//不对的有坑禁止使用foreach删除、增加List元素
// for (int i = 0; i < dbxjjh.size(); i++) {
// if (dbxjjh.get(i).isChecked()) {
// dbxjjh.remove(dbxjjh.get(i));
// }
// }
//刷新页面
initData();

Loading…
Cancel
Save